a project on POSIX threads and synchronization using C/C++. it simulates ticket sellers simultaneously selling concert tickets during one hour. there are 100 seats available to a concert. One ticket seller named H sells high-priced tickets, three ticket sellers named M1, M2, and M3 sell medium-priced tickets, and six ticket sellers named L1, L2, L3, L4, L5, and L6 sell low-priced tickets. Each ticket seller has a separate customer queue. All the ticket sellers work simultaneously during one hour. Each seller can expect N customers to arrive at random times during the hour, where N is a command-line parameter.
